Risk Management Methods

1. Know Your Customer (KYC) Procedures: One of the most important risk management methods employed by online gambling platforms is the implementation of KYC procedures. This involves verifying the identity of players and ensuring they are of legal age to gamble. By verifying the identity of players, online casinos can prevent underage gambling and protect against fraud and money laundering.

2. Responsible Gambling Tools: Many online gambling platforms offer responsible gambling tools to help players manage their gambling habits. These tools include setting de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ks to remind players of the amount of time and money they have spent gambling. By providing these tools, online casinos can help players identify and address potential gambling problems before they escalate.

3. Secure Payment Systems: Online gambling platforms use secure payment systems to protect the financial information of their players. By encrypting transactions and using secure servers, online casinos can prevent unauthorized access to players’ funds and personal data. This helps to protect players from fraud and ensures that their financial information remains safe.

4. Fair Play Policies: Online gambling platforms employ fair play policies to ensure that all games are conducted in a fair and transparent manner. This includes using random number generators (RNGs) to determine game outcomes and regularly auditing games to ensure they are operating fairly. By maintaining fair play policies, online casinos can build trust with their players and attract new customers.

Common Mistakes Gamblers Make

1. Chasing Losses: One common mistake that many gamblers make is chasing losses. Instead of accepting defeat and walking away, some players will continue to gamble in the hopes of recouping their losses. This can lead to further financial losses and may exacerbate gambling problems.

2. Ignoring Bankroll Management: Another common mistake is ignoring bankroll management. Players who do not set limits on how much they can afford to lose are more likely to overspend and chase losses. By practicing good bankroll management, players can set limits on their gambling activities and avoid financial difficulties.

3. Playing Under the Influence: Playing under the influence of alcohol or drugs can impair judgment and lead to reckless gambling behavior. Gamblers who are not in a clear state of mind are more likely to make impulsive decisions and take greater risks. It is important to play online games with a clear mind to make informed decisions.

4. Not Reading Terms and Conditions: Many gamblers make the mistake of not reading the terms and conditions of online gambling platforms. This can result in misunderstandings about bonus offers, withdrawal restrictions, and other important information. By thoroughly reviewing the terms and conditions, players can avoid potential disputes and ensure they are playing within the rules.
